I wanted to share the lyrics to a song that I wrote. The name of the song is called Puddles of Pain. A buddy of mine has been struggling with his marriage coming to a crashing halt. This song was going to be about his story and his feelings and struggles. I was going to use actual situations and incorporate them into the song but that didn 't happen. It changed as I wrote it. Hopefully the song catches the feeling of losing someone.
Puddles of Pain
copyright Jim McCarter
Water pours like a waterfall
on a rainy Kansas day.
I stomp down on the gas
in my beat up Chevrolet.
My hands grip the steering wheel
Receipt in my shirt pocket.
Life is like a sad song
of love and how I lost it.
Chorus- The rain falls down
and pain is all around
Rain everywhere I go.
I'm driving through puddles
Puddles of Pain.
This morning drove by a pawn shop
saw her ring on display
The clerk behind the counter
said, " He bought it yesterday."
I asked, "Can I hold it?"
that diamond it still shined.
I flipped out my Visa
Yeah, It's mine a second time.
The rain falls down
and pain is all around
Rain everywhere I go.
I'm driving through puddles
Puddles of pain.
The weatherman the radio
said, "The forecast is bright.
Storms will pass through
and stars will shine tonight.
The rain falls down
and pain is all around.
Rain everywhere I go.
I'm driving through puddles
Puddles of Pain.
